The set design-forest-green awnings, butter-coloured walls, oak woodwork-is picturesque. At brunch you'll find hip mommies, old friends, and neighbourhood denizens nibbling modern bistro fare: poached eggs with hollandaise and back bacon ($12), juicy lamb burgers with aged cheddar and red onion jam ($17). Poached eggs with hollandaise outstanding
July 26, 2014

I am something of an eggs benny addict but the way Trafalgar cooks this dish is truly exceptional. The eggs are served on a potato latke and the bacon is home-cured. The hollandaise has the perfect degree of tartness and the eggs are poached exactly the way you specify.

Trafalgar is rumored to have some of the best desserts in Vancouver and it lives up to that reputation. The wine and dessert pairings are inspired. It is a very romantic place to go to for a date. If you want their dessert for a bit cheaper, go to sweet obsessions next door. It shares a kitchen with Trafalgar and sells their desserts at a sweeter price.
